Position Specific Description

The Central Maintenance Department is looking for a Sr Arborist to join their team in Ormond Beach, FL.

The selected candidate for this role will be responsible for the following:

Planning and Strategy - Developing plans and strategies for vegetation management, including pruning, clearing, and maintenance, to ensure safety, and regulatory compliance are met.
Reliability support - Work to ensure outages are investigated. Ensure proper patrols are done and documentation is collected. Coordinate closely with electrical repair crews for safe and rapid grounding, line clearing and restoration efforts. Help oversee high impact outage events and major storms.
Team Management - Leading a team of field workers, Arborists and Technicians involved in vegetation management tasks.
Budget Management - Managing budgets for vegetation management projects, ensuring cost-effective requirements for safe production.
Environmental Considerations - Assessing and minimizing the environmental impact of vegetation management practices, including adhering to conservation and sustainability principles.
Resource Management - Overseeing the deployment of the required amount of equipment, materials and personnel needed for efficient resource allocation.
Client and Stakeholder Communication - Liaising with clients, government agencies, and other stakeholders to provide updates on progress, address concerns, and ensure compliance with contractual obligations.
Work Execution - Ensure Arborists are completing audits and inspections in adherence to federal and state regulatory compliance and may from time to time directly oversee line clearing activities.
Record Keeping and Reporting - Maintaining records of vegetation management activities, including work performed, expenses, and compliance documentation.
Innovation and Technology - Keeping abreast of industry trends and implement new technologies to improve the efficiencies of safe, productive vegetation management operations.
Support and growth - Develop talent and motivate reports to grow and learn in the required competencies.


Job Overview

Employees in this position oversee the implementation of business unit vegetation management. This position ensures compliance with all laws and regulations. Employees is in this position develop action plans to improve inspection and work performance and quality. Employees in this role drive reliability improvements, increase customer experience and satisfaction and ensure work execution within established guidelines and budgets. Employees respond to elevated customer concerns and make decisions with impact to company brand. Employees in this role respond to customer outages during regular weather and natural disasters.


Job Duties & Responsibilities

Audits inspections to ensure federal and state regulatory compliance and directly oversees line clearing activities for the regulated utility as well as NEER and NEET assests

Coordinates closely with Distribution Control Center (power systems operations) and electrical repair crews for safe and rapid grounding, line clearing and restoration efforts
Works with and coordinates with elected officials and government leadership to advocate for legislation and programs which enable customers to plant trees away from power lines
Oversees day-to-day operations for a large workfoce including budgetary approvals and process compliance activities
Resolves customer complaints and inquires promptly and supports legal requests
Coordinates with engineering teams to ensure proper clearances and vegetation clearing techniques during pre-construction activities for major work
Promotes safety consciousness and adherence to OSHA and company safety requirements to achieve an injury free work environment and motivates and develops employees
Ensures the inspection of all work performed is in accordance with contract scope and specifications
Designs, schedules, approves, and oversees work scope for all hardening, preventative maintenance, customer trim requests and capital scope work
Supports reactive work including: regularly occuring outages, high impact outage events, major storm restoration and out of area travel
Performs other job-related duties as assigned
